Background
The water spray tower is used as a pretreatment device in waste gas treatment, plays a role in dedusting and cooling, plays a key role in many waste gas treatment, and is commonly used in the absorption process of extremely fast or rapid chemical reaction or spray dedusting. In order to reduce water consumption in a chemical reaction or dust removal process, spray liquid is generally recycled, however, after the spray liquid washes or adsorbs certain components in waste gas, a large amount of foam is generated, particularly under the condition that the pressure in a spray tower is high, high-density foam (water content) in the spray liquid is more, and the high-density foam is not easy to break, so that a large amount of gas can be carried in the spray liquid, when the high-density foam enters a water pump, the stress of a water pump blade in the rotating process is not uniform, so that the water pump blade is damaged, the power consumption of the water pump is increased, so that the energy consumption and equipment loss of spray dust removal are increased, a cyclone plate is generally arranged in a cyclone plate tower, when the dust-containing flue gas flows upwards from the bottom of the tower during operation, the flue gas is rotated and ascended due to the guiding effect of the cyclone plate blade, so that the liquid flowing upwards and downwards on the tower plate, the existing spray tower is often used to directly spray liquid to the inside through a nozzle, the impurity removal effect is extremely poor, and when the spray liquid is recycled by a water pump, pump blades are easily damaged due to impurities such as bubbles, dust and the like, the working progress is greatly influenced, and the working cost is increased.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1, fig. 2 and fig. 3, the present invention provides the following technical solutions: an environment-friendly rotational flow water treatment spray tower comprises a spray tower main body 1, wherein the top of the spray tower main body 1 is connected with a gas outlet 8, the top of the gas outlet 8 is provided with a cover plate 9, the outer wall of one side of the spray tower main body 1 is connected with a controller 10, a gas inlet 13 and a motor 14, the outer wall of the other side of the spray tower main body 1 is connected with a water outlet 17, the controller 10 is positioned above the gas inlet 13, the gas inlet 13 is positioned above the motor 14, the outer surface of the gas inlet 13 is provided with a control valve 12, the output end of the motor 14 extends into the spray tower main body 1 and is connected with a stirring rod 2, one end of the water outlet 17, which is far away from the spray tower main body 1, is connected with a water storage tank 3, the inside of the water storage tank 3 is provided with a water pump 16, one end of the water pump 16 is connected with a water inlet pipe 5, one, the inner part of the spray tower main body 1 close to the bottoms of the first spray pipeline 7 and the second spray pipeline 18 is provided with a rotational flow plate 4, clean water is sprayed to the rotational flow plate 4 through the spray head 6, so that the clean water above the rotational flow plate 4 forms a water film due to the rotation of the rotational flow plate 4, thereby the waste gas in the spray tower main body 1 can be filtered more cleanly and thoroughly, and the waste gas can be filtered by the water pump 16 and the water inlet pipe 5, so that the clean water in the spray tower main body 1 can be recycled, the hydraulic resource is greatly saved, the purification cost is reduced, finally, the gas and the impurities in the sprayed water flow are removed through the stirring rod 2, thereby preventing the spray liquid from carrying a large amount of air to enter the pump body of the water pump 16, reducing the loss of the water pump 16, prolonging the service life of the water pump 16 and also improving the service life of the utility model, the motor 14, the water pump 16 and the rotational flow plate 4 are electrically connected with the controller 10 and the mobile power supply through wires;
referring to fig. 1 and 2, the two rotational flow plates 4 rotate in opposite directions, and the upper rotational flow plate 4 rotates clockwise, so that a vortex space is formed between the two rotational flow plates 4 by the opposite rotation of the two rotational flow plates 4, thereby effectively improving the atomization effect and greatly increasing the removal effect of the impurities in the exhaust gas;
referring to fig. 3, a filter plate 15 is disposed inside the water outlet 17, and filter holes are disposed inside the filter plate 15, so that impurities in the sprayed water flow are blocked outside the filter plate 15, thereby preventing the sprayed liquid from carrying a large amount of impurities into the pump body of the water pump 16, reducing the loss of the water pump 16, prolonging the service life of the water pump 16, and also prolonging the service life of the utility model;
referring to fig. 1, two groups of spray heads 6 are arranged, ten spray heads are arranged in each group, and the ten spray heads are respectively and uniformly distributed at the bottoms of the first spray pipeline 7 and the second spray pipeline 18, so that the spray effect is better through the synergistic effect of the plurality of spray heads 6, and the working efficiency is greatly improved;
referring to fig. 1, the outer surface of the controller 10 is provided with four control switches 11, the four control switches 11 are uniformly distributed on the outer surface of the controller 10, and the corresponding electrical appliances are controlled by controlling the different control switches 11, so that an operator can operate the device more easily and conveniently, and the operation difficulty of the device is greatly reduced.
The working principle is as follows: the staff opens the control valve 12 first, and let the waste gas into the inside of the spray tower main body 1 through the air inlet 13, then open the water pump 16 through the control switch 11, the whirl plate 4 and the motor 14, make the shower nozzle 6 spray the spray liquid to the top of the whirl plate 4, and remove the impurity in the waste gas through the vortex space and the water film of the double-deck whirl plate 4, thereby greatly increasing the removal effect of the waste gas impurity, and recycle the spray liquid through the water pump 16, thereby greatly saving hydraulic resources, and reducing the purification cost, when the water pump 16 works, in order to prevent the spray liquid from being mixed with a large amount of air and dust impurity inside to cause the pump plate to be damaged because of uneven stress, the staff needs to drive the stirring rod 2 to rotate by opening the motor 14, and often change the clean filter plate 15, make the gas and impurity in the water flow after spraying be cleared and separated, and then avoid spraying in the liquid carries a large amount of air and dust and gets into the pump body of water pump 16, reduce water pump 16's loss, prolonged water pump 16's life, also improved the utility model discloses a life, at last, through spraying the waste gas of purification and discharging from gas outlet 8.
